Smoketree

Location: Campanile, Malott 
Approximate blooming period: June - August

Smoketree ‘Royal Purple, Cotinus coggygria

Origin: China/Himalaya
Habitat: Hardy to USDA Zone 5 or even 4 if in a protected locations
Height and Form: Deciduous shrub or small tree12-15 ft (3.5-4.5 m) tall and nearly double in width.
Foliage: maroon-red in spring and darkening to purplish red, but may be greenish in late summer, but may become scarlet in fall
Flowers, Fruit and Seeds: The upper surface of leaves often with a pink margin, underside is green.
